Uwe Hermann 09f70836fd This is the first part of a v3 Super I/O refactoring.
Add a small collection of PNP enter/exit functions for many Super I/Os.
Use these functions instead of duplicating them for each chip.

static void w83627thg_init(struct device * dev)
{
struct superio_winbond_w83627thg_config *conf;
struct resource *res0, *res1;
/* Wishlist handle well known programming interfaces more
* generically.
*/
if (!dev->enabled) {
return;
}
conf = dev->device_configuration;
switch(dev->path.pnp.device) {
case W83627THG_SP1:
res0 = find_resource(dev, PNP_IDX_IO0);
// init_uart8250(res0->base, &conf->com1);
break;
case W83627THG_SP2:
res0 = find_resource(dev, PNP_IDX_IO0);
// init_uart8250(res0->base, &conf->com2);
break;
case W83627THG_KBC:
res0 = find_resource(dev, PNP_IDX_IO0);
res1 = find_resource(dev, PNP_IDX_IO1);
// init_pc_keyboard(res0->base, res1->base, &conf->keyboard);
break;
}
}
static void w83627thg_set_resources(struct device * dev)
{
pnp_enter_8787(dev);
pnp_set_resources(dev);
pnp_exit_aa(dev);
}
static void w83627thg_enable_resources(struct device * dev)
{
pnp_enter_8787(dev);
pnp_enable_resources(dev);
pnp_exit_aa(dev);
}
static void w83627thg_enable(struct device * dev)
{
pnp_enter_8787(dev);
pnp_enable(dev);
pnp_exit_aa(dev);
}
static void phase3_chip_setup_dev(struct device *dev);
struct device_operations w83627thg_ops = {
.phase3_chip_setup_dev = phase3_chip_setup_dev,
.phase3_enable = w83627thg_enable,
.phase4_read_resources = pnp_read_resources,
.phase4_set_resources = w83627thg_set_resources,
.phase5_enable_resources = w83627thg_enable_resources,
.phase6_init = w83627thg_init,
};
/* TODO: this device is not at all filled out. Just copied from v2. */
static struct pnp_info pnp_dev_info[] = {
{ &w83627thg_ops, W83627THG_FDC, 0, PNP_IO0 | PNP_IRQ0 | PNP_DRQ0, { 0x07f8, 0}, },
{ &w83627thg_ops, W83627THG_PP, 0, PNP_IO0 | PNP_IRQ0 | PNP_DRQ0, { 0x07f8, 0}, },
{ &w83627thg_ops, W83627THG_SP1, 0, PNP_IO0 | PNP_IRQ0, { 0x7f8, 0 }, },
{ &w83627thg_ops, W83627THG_SP2, 0, PNP_IO0 | PNP_IRQ0, { 0x7f8, 0 }, },
// No 4 { 0,},
{ &w83627thg_ops, W83627THG_KBC, 0, PNP_IO0 | PNP_IO1 | PNP_IRQ0 | PNP_IRQ1, { 0x7ff, 0 }, { 0x7ff, 0x4}, },
{ &w83627thg_ops, W83627THG_GAME_MIDI_GPIO1, 0, PNP_IO0 | PNP_IO1 | PNP_IRQ0, { 0x7ff, 0 }, {0x7fe, 4} },
{ &w83627thg_ops, W83627THG_GPIO2,},
{ &w83627thg_ops, W83627THG_GPIO3,},
{ &w83627thg_ops, W83627THG_ACPI, 0, PNP_IRQ0, },
{ &w83627thg_ops, W83627THG_HWM, 0, PNP_IO0 | PNP_IRQ0, { 0xff8, 0 } },
};
